Falling nickel prices hitting higher cost producers

Report by Global Mining Research

After a good 2022, nickel prices are now feeling the pressure of rising Indonesian production and generally soft economic conditions. Although nickel equities don’t appear expensive for the long-term, shares are now fighting a headwind of lower prices and margins are compressed enough that several would be in difficultly should prices weaken another 10-20%. David Radclyffe’s views are mostly negative to neutral, his preferred nickel equities are IGO and Sherritt, while he has SELL ratings on Vale Indonesia, Norilsk Nickel and Nickel Industries.
